In a graphic novel, graphic weight is basically how certain elements stand out or have more impact visually. It could be a big, bold image or a prominently placed piece of text that catches the reader's attention and conveys significance.
A class a graphic novel often has high - quality art. The illustrations are detailed, expressive, and enhance the story. For example, in 'Maus' by Art Spiegelman, the simple yet powerful black - and - white drawings add depth to the harrowing tale of the Holocaust. It also typically has a well - crafted story. The plot should be engaging, with well - developed characters and a clear narrative arc. Good pacing is crucial too, keeping the reader interested from start to finish.

Some essential graphic techniques in a graphic novel include panel layout. Different panel sizes and arrangements can control the pacing and flow of the story. For example, a series of small panels might speed up the action, while a large, full - page panel can be used for a dramatic moment. Another important technique is the use of line work. Thick lines can denote strength or importance, while thin, wispy lines might suggest delicacy or mystery. Also, shading and coloring play significant roles. Darker shading can create a sense of depth or gloom, and the color palette can set the mood of the entire story, like using warm colors for a happy or energetic scene and cool colors for a somber or cold atmosphere.
The 'graphic weight' in a graphic novel can refer to the visual impact or emphasis created by the graphics. For example, a large, detailed, and darkly shaded image may have more graphic weight than a small, simple, and lightly colored one. It can also relate to how the graphics draw the reader's attention and contribute to the overall mood and pacing of the story.
